Manufacturer |
Lucas Logic Systems (UK) |
Model |
NASCOM 3 |
Date Launched |
Late 1981 |
Price |
£630 for NASCOM 3 |
Microprocessor type |
Zilog Z80A @ 4 MHz |
ROM size |
10 kilobytes |
Standard RAM |
8 kilobytes |
Maximum RAM |
60 kilobytes |
Keyboard type |
Typewriter style |
Supplied language |
Microsoft-style BASIC |
Text resolution |
48 x 16 characters |
Graphics resolution |
96 x 48 pixels using character graphics. |
Colours available |
Monochrome |
Sound |
None |
Cassette load speed |
1200 baud |
Dimensions (mm) |
450 x 450 x 120 very approx. |
Special features |
16 input/output lines |
Good points |
Designed for interfacing to external hardware. |
Bad points |
Intended for the expert hobbyist producing his own hardware and software, rather than the general market. |
How successful? |
Never really sold outside the (diminishing) enthusiast market. |
Comments |
Because the NASCOM 3 was designed to be adapted and expanded by the owner, there was really no 'standard' specification. |
